What Does a FHA Loan Specialist in Bonita Springs Cost?
Typical costs for an FHA loan in Florida include an upfront mortgage insurance premium (UFMIP) of 1.75 percent of the loan amount and an annual mortgage insurance premium (MIP) ranging from 0.45 to 1.05 percent depending on loan term and loan-to-value ratio. Closing costs in Bonita Springs generally range from 2 to 5 percent of the purchase price. Lender fees origination fees and appraisal costs vary by lender.
